Understanding the Impact of Burping Jars on Cannabis Curing

The Myth of Burping and Tarpine Loss

  • The act of burping a curing jar releases volatile compounds, specifically tarpenes, which can lead to significant loss during the curing process.
  • There are conflicting opinions in forums regarding how often to burp jars; one camp advocates for daily burps while another warns against it due to potential tarpine leaks.
  • A newer argument suggests that expanding gas builds pressure in the headspace, causing tarpenes to escape with each burp, potentially wasting up to 30% of oils.

Scientific Principles Behind Tarpine Behavior

  • Tarpines are liquids dissolved in resin that evaporate until equilibrium is reached based on temperature and vapor pressure.
  • Dried flour does not generate meaningful pressure; thus, there is no significant loss from burping as claimed by some sources.
  • Real-world observations show that cured flour retains its aroma even after months, indicating minimal loss from occasional burping.

Quantifying Tarpine Loss During Curing

  • Measurements indicate that a half-full quart jar has about half a liter of headspace; opening it results in minimal tarpine loss—approximately 1% over an entire cure.
  • Research shows that most oil loss occurs during drying rather than curing; nearly a third is lost within the first week before jarring.

Factors Affecting Tarpine Retention

  • Volatility varies among different compounds; lighter molecules like mercene evaporate faster than heavier ones like keraphilene.
  • Drying affects the concentration of these compounds but does not change their presence. Recognizable aromas remain despite changes in intensity.

Temperature's Role in Tarpine Preservation

  • Higher temperatures increase evaporation rates significantly; studies show room temperature storage leads to substantial oil loss over time.
  • Time is identified as a critical factor for potency loss, overshadowing concerns about how often jars are opened.

Misconceptions About Oxygen and Oxidation

  • Each burp introduces fresh air but does not significantly alter oxygen levels since jars initially contain ambient air composition.
  • Studies reveal nitrogen sealing does not enhance preservation compared to regular air sealing; oxidation effects depend more on time and light exposure.

Managing Moisture Levels During Curing

  • Burping serves primarily as moisture management by releasing humid air trapped inside jars, preventing mold growth during curing.

Best Practices for Cannabis Storage

  • Maintaining optimal water activity (between 0.55 and 0.65), measured with hydrometers, ensures maximum tarpine retention without risking mold development.

Conclusion: Reevaluating Burping Ritual

  • The focus should shift from frequent burping rituals towards monitoring humidity levels accurately for effective cannabis storage.

Burping your curing jars is not what loses your terpenes, and the reason you burp at all is water, not smell. Here is how often to burp jars, when to stop, and the number that decides it. The "every burp leaks your terpenes" story sounds like physics, but the headspace math puts a whole month of daily burping at a fraction of a percent of your terpene content, while the drying phase takes about a third of the volatile oil in the first week (University of Mississippi, 1996). This episode ranks the real levers in order — drying temperature and speed, storage temperature, time, light, seal — shows why a sealed jar already holds 21% oxygen and why a nitrogen-storage trial found the seal doing the work, sets the water activity your cured buds should sit at (0.55–0.65), and replaces the burping calendar with a hygrometer reading. 0:00 Does Burping Your Jars Really Leak Terpenes? 1:48 What's Actually in the Headspace?
